Applied Scientist II and Senior Applied Scientist (Multiple Positions) - Microsoft Excel team

Do you want to be part of a team which delivers innovative AI features across flagship products? Does the opportunity to join a fast-paced, high-visibility, diverse team in a highly competitive market sound exciting to you? If so, the Microsoft Excel team has great opportunities for you. 

We are seeking Applied Scientist II's and Senior Applied Scientist with a proven track record of shipping at-scale intelligent systems. You will architect, design and ship intelligent systems assisting users writing code for Microsoft Excel using state-of-the-art techniques in large language models, deep learning, program synthesis and information retrieval. You will collaborate with world-class engineers in a fast-paced, dynamic and learning-oriented environment, creating AI applications that solve real-world problems for customers around the world.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ct rigorous analysis to evaluate the performance of intelligent applications, identify areas for improvement, and iterate. 
  • Executing projects from design through implementation, experimentation and finally shipping to our users. 
  • Integrate experiments into production systems by implementing them and maintain and optimize their performance. 
  • Understand broad areas of research and techniques, as well as a knowledge of industry trends to apply this in the product. 
  • Prepare data for analysis by applying quality and technical constraints. Review data and suggest data to be included and excluded and address data quality problems. 
  • Assist with the development of usable datasets for modeling purposes and support the scaling of product ideas. 
  • Embody our Culture and Values 

Qualifications

Required Qualifications: 

  • Bachelor's Degree in Statistics, Econometrics, Computer Science, Electrical or Computer Engineering, or related field AND 2+ years related experience (e.g., statistics, predictive analytics, research)
    • OR Master's Degree in Statistics, Econometrics, Computer Science, Electrical or Computer Engineering, or related field AND 1+ year(s) related experience (e.g., statistics, predictive analytics, research)
    • OR Doctorate in Statistics, Econometrics, Computer Science, Electrical or Computer Engineering, or related field
    • OR equivalent experience.
  • 1+ years experience in applying machine learning techniques and driving end-to-end AI product development. 
  • 1+ years experience working with Large Language Models. 

Other Requirements:


Ability to meet Microsoft, customer and/or government security screening requirements are required for this role. These requirements include but are not limited to the following specialized security screenings:

  • Microsoft Cloud Background Check: This position will be required to pass the Microsoft Cloud background check upon hire/transfer and every two years thereafter.
